Souhegan lost against Pelham back in January of 2024 and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Friday. The Souhegan Sabers were outmatched by the Pelham Pythons and fell 62-29. The Sabers have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Souhegan's defeat dropped their record down to 3-5. As for Pelham,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 5-3.
Souhegan will be playing at home against Derryfield at 7:00 p.m. on January 24th. As for Pelham, they will square off against Merrimack Valley at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day.
